| @FixMethodOrder(MethodSorters.NAME_ASCENDING) |
| public class KeepAliveTest extends BaseTestSupport { |
| |
| private static final long HEARTBEAT = TimeUnit.SECONDS.toMillis(2L); |
| private static final long TIMEOUT = 2L * HEARTBEAT; |
| private static final long WAIT = 2L * TIMEOUT; |
| |
| private SshServer sshd; |
| private int port; |
| |
| public KeepAliveTest() { |
| super(); |
| } |
| |
| @Before |
| public void setUp() throws Exception { |
| sshd = setupTestServer(); |
| PropertyResolverUtils.updateProperty(sshd, FactoryManager.IDLE_TIMEOUT, TIMEOUT); |
| sshd.setShellFactory(new TestEchoShellFactory()); |
| sshd.start(); |
| port = sshd.getPort(); |
| } |
| |
| @After |
| public void tearDown() throws Exception { |
| if (sshd != null) { |
| sshd.stop(true); |
| } |
| } |
| |
| @Test |
| public void testIdleClient() throws Exception { |
| SshClient client = setupTestClient(); |
| client.start(); |
| |
| try (ClientSession session = client.connect(getCurrentTestName(), TEST_LOCALHOST, port).verify(7L, TimeUnit.SECONDS).getSession()) { |
| session.addPasswordIdentity(getCurrentTestName()); |
| session.auth().verify(5L, TimeUnit.SECONDS); |
| |
| try (ClientChannel channel = session.createChannel(Channel.CHANNEL_SHELL)) { |
| Collection<ClientChannelEvent> result = |
| channel.waitFor(EnumSet.of(ClientChannelEvent.CLOSED), WAIT); |
| assertTrue("Wrong channel state: " + result, result.containsAll(EnumSet.of(ClientChannelEvent.CLOSED))); |
| } |
| } finally { |
| client.stop(); |
| } |
| } |
| |
| @Test |
| public void testClientWithHeartBeat() throws Exception { |
| SshClient client = setupTestClient(); |
| PropertyResolverUtils.updateProperty(client, ClientFactoryManager.HEARTBEAT_INTERVAL, HEARTBEAT); |
| client.start(); |
| |
| try (ClientSession session = client.connect(getCurrentTestName(), TEST_LOCALHOST, port).verify(7L, TimeUnit.SECONDS).getSession()) { |
| session.addPasswordIdentity(getCurrentTestName()); |
| session.auth().verify(5L, TimeUnit.SECONDS); |
| |
| try (ClientChannel channel = session.createChannel(Channel.CHANNEL_SHELL)) { |
| Collection<ClientChannelEvent> result = |
| channel.waitFor(EnumSet.of(ClientChannelEvent.CLOSED), WAIT); |
| assertTrue("Wrong channel state: " + result, result.contains(ClientChannelEvent.TIMEOUT)); |
| } |
| } finally { |
| client.stop(); |
| } |
| } |
| |
| @Test |
| public void testShellClosedOnClientTimeout() throws Exception { |
| TestEchoShell.latch = new CountDownLatch(1); |
| |
| SshClient client = setupTestClient(); |
| client.start(); |
| |
| try (ClientSession session = client.connect(getCurrentTestName(), TEST_LOCALHOST, port).verify(7L, TimeUnit.SECONDS).getSession()) { |
| session.addPasswordIdentity(getCurrentTestName()); |
| session.auth().verify(5L, TimeUnit.SECONDS); |
| |
| try (ClientChannel channel = session.createChannel(Channel.CHANNEL_SHELL); |
| ByteArrayOutputStream out = new ByteArrayOutputStream(); |
| ByteArrayOutputStream err = new ByteArrayOutputStream()) { |
| |
| channel.setOut(out); |
| channel.setErr(err); |
| channel.open().verify(9L, TimeUnit.SECONDS); |
| |
| assertTrue("Latch time out", TestEchoShell.latch.await(10L, TimeUnit.SECONDS)); |
| Collection<ClientChannelEvent> result = |
| channel.waitFor(EnumSet.of(ClientChannelEvent.CLOSED), WAIT); |
| assertTrue("Wrong channel state: " + result, |
| result.containsAll( |
| EnumSet.of(ClientChannelEvent.CLOSED, ClientChannelEvent.OPENED))); |
| } |
| } finally { |
| TestEchoShell.latch = null; |
| client.stop(); |
| } |
| } |
| |
| public static class TestEchoShellFactory extends EchoShellFactory { |
| @Override |
| public Command create() { |
| return new TestEchoShell(); |
| } |
| } |
| |
| public static class TestEchoShell extends EchoShell { |
| // CHECKSTYLE:OFF |
| public static CountDownLatch latch; |
| // CHECKSTYLE:ON |
| |
| @Override |
| public void destroy() { |
| if (latch != null) { |
| latch.countDown(); |
| } |
| super.destroy(); |
| } |
| } |
| } |
